摘要

It has excellent optical properties and can form various three-dimensional images. Manufacture of optical films for stereoscopic images that can be widely used in various areas such as sign boards, advertisement exhibition halls, and exhibition boxes by using the method to form three-dimensional security patterns, and optical films that can quickly and efficiently manufacture such optical films An apparatus, a method for manufacturing an optical film, and an advertisement board made of the optical film are provided. The optical film for a stereoscopic image includes a base film layer, and a lens array comprising a plurality of microlenses protruding from one surface of the base film layer, and a gap partitioning between the microlenses so that the microlenses are spaced apart from each other, The ratio b/a of the thickness b of the microlens to the diameter a of the lens is 0.5 or more, and the ratio b/c of the thickness b of the microlens to the gap c is 1 or more.
